Key Features and Specifications of Upgrade ANC & ENC Headset
The most useful way to read this headset is as a communications device with a few clear priorities.
It is meant to keep outside noise down, preserve speech quality, and work cleanly with common computer setups.
Here are the core facts from the listing:
- Hybrid Active Noise Cancellation for reducing what you hear from the environment
- Environmental Noise Cancellation through the microphone for clearer outgoing voice pickup
- Qualcomm USB-A dongle for low-latency, plug-and-play PC or Mac use
- Bluetooth 5.4 for wireless pairing and lower battery consumption
- Dual connectivity so it can stay connected to two devices at once
- Flip-to-mute microphone boom for fast physical mute control
- 270-degree rotatable microphone
- Breathable leather ear cushions and an adjustable headband
- About 33-foot operating range
- About 2-hour charge time
- Up to 35 hours of talk time or 50 hours of music playback
The listing also says the dongle is not compatible with landlines, desk phones, or VoIP phones, which is an important limitation.
If your workflow depends on those systems, this is not the right fit.

How the Upgrade ANC & ENC Headset Handles Daily Work
Noise Control for Calls
The main reason to consider this headset is the paired ANC and ENC story.
ANC is meant to reduce what you hear around you, while ENC is aimed at keeping your voice clear on the other end.
For open offices, shared homes, or busy workspaces, that split matters because it addresses both sides of the call.
Mute and Device Switching
The flip-to-mute boom mic is one of the more practical details in the listing.
Physical mute control is useful when you need to react quickly in a call, and it avoids some of the friction that comes with software-based toggles.
Dual connectivity is another genuine work benefit if you regularly bounce between a computer and a second device.
Fit and Long-Session Comfort
The headset uses breathable leather ear cushions, an adjustable headband, and a 270-degree rotatable microphone.
Those are the kind of details that matter more after the first hour of a shift than they do in a short demo.
Based on the listing alone, this is built to stay comfortable during long stretches rather than to make a style statement.
Battery and Desk-to-Travel Use
The claimed 35 hours of talk time and 50 hours of music time put it in the range of a headset you can use across several workdays before needing a charge.
The two-hour charging claim is useful too, since long battery life is only helpful if recharge time stays manageable.
